Daniel El Keslassy Eliminated in 13th Place (€12,678)

Daniel El Keslassy - 13th place
Daniel El Keslassy - 13th place

Daniel El Keslassy of Morocco opened with a raise to 30,000, then Joel Benzinou reraised to 80,000 behind him. It folded back to El Keslassy who pushed all in for 355,000 total, and Benzinou quickly made the call. As it turned out, the pair had nearly identical stacks prior to the hand, with El Keslassy having the young Belgian outchipped by just 6,000.

El Keslassy had {A-Clubs}{J-Diamonds} and Benzinou {A-Hearts}{K-Spades}, and after the next five cards came {6-Diamonds}{4-Diamonds}{3-Spades}{9-Hearts}{10-Spades}, Benzinou had doubled and El Keslassy was all but done.

A third of his stack went in as the ante in the next hand, and El Keslassy put the other 4,000 in when given the opportunity. Patrick Muleta then raised to 24,000 from the small blind, and Benzinou called from the big blind. Both checked the {10-Clubs}{J-Clubs}{Q-Spades} flop and {2-Diamonds} turn. The river brought the {J-Diamonds}, and when Muleta checked, Benzinou bet 32,000, and Muleta folded. Benzinou showed {A-Diamonds}{J-Hearts} for trip jacks. Keslassy turned up his {K-Spades}{10-Hearts}, then shook Benzinou's hand as he left.

Benzinou is now up to 725,000.
